Original Abstract
The aims of this tbook are two. First, to establish the theory of regular and rapid variation on time scales, which would naturally supplement and extend the existing theory of regular and rapid variation from the continuous and discrete case. Second, to apply the obtained theory in a study of asymptotic behavior of solutions to linear and half-linear second order dynamic equations on time scales.
